Le Tanneur Mid-Century French Leather Boxed Bridge Card Playing & Betting Set
By Le Tanneur
Located in Philadelphia, PA
A Mid-Century boxed card Bridge set manufactured by the well known French luxury leather goods company Le Tanneur, circa 1960’s.
The prestigious French leather goods company, LE TANNEUR began in 1898 with their line of luxury items called Le Sans Couture. Le Tanneur is known for their timeless elegance and quality.
The wood box is covered in a fine-grained tanned black leather with a magnetic gold-tone clasp. The box is beautifully made, lined in green felt, and still in the original brand printed cardboard box. The set includes a full deck of playing cards, colorful plastic betting chips and tokens that store in fitted covered containers, and a gold-plated pencil for keeping score. Also included is a pad of scoring paper...
